Solution for 13r+5=r-7 equation:


Simplifying
13r + 5 = r + -7

Reorder the terms:
5 + 13r = r + -7

Reorder the terms:
5 + 13r = -7 + r

Solving
5 + 13r = -7 + r

Solving for variable 'r'.

Move all terms containing r to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-1r' to each side of the equation.
5 + 13r + -1r = -7 + r + -1r

Combine like terms: 13r + -1r = 12r
5 + 12r = -7 + r + -1r

Combine like terms: r + -1r = 0
5 + 12r = -7 + 0
5 + 12r = -7

Add '-5' to each side of the equation.
5 + -5 + 12r = -7 + -5

Combine like terms: 5 + -5 = 0
0 + 12r = -7 + -5
12r = -7 + -5

Combine like terms: -7 + -5 = -12
12r = -12

Divide each side by '12'.
r = -1

Simplifying
r = -1
